"Tractor Principles" by Roger B. Whitman is a comprehensive manual detailing the inner workings of early gas engine tractors, emphasizing the importance of mechanical knowledge for successful operation and upkeep. It begins by differentiating tractors from automobiles, underlining that operators must thoroughly understand their tractor's unique design due to variations among manufacturers. The book emphasizes the necessity of understanding essential components such as the engine, clutch, and transmission, and how skillful handling translates to improved efficiency. It lays the groundwork for a detailed analysis of each component and concept vital to tractor functionality.
